The digital format of the PDF offers a unique utility for these complex sequences. Unlike a physical book, a PDF allows the folder to zoom in on specific steps—a crucial advantage when deciphering the dense crease patterns often associated with dragon designs. Furthermore, the "Premium" aspect of the title suggests a focus on aesthetic refinement. The essayist must note that these are not merely folded shapes; they are studies in shaping (the art of wet-folding or precise molding). The diagrams often include subtle notes on "paper tension" and "shaping tips," acknowledging that in modern origami, the folding of the base is only half the battle; the sculpting of the final model is where the dragon truly comes to life.
